Output b3a124128060faab32411a5acc16972be287f1b8659cbe83b493e994e8ef55c5:0

value
1018146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c068f1021950b347ccdf0229b1e86802c41a2477 OP_EQUAL
address
3KEPNqLM41Z6SYognTcUXiKvk6TvU1sfGp
transaction
b3a124128060faab32411a5acc16972be287f1b8659cbe83b493e994e8ef55c5
confirmations
266544
spent
true